Best Places to Visit in Kerala with Family

Munnar

Munnar is a strong choice for families who enjoy mountains, tea gardens and nature. The cooler climate and scenic surroundings make it suitable for a relaxed family stay. Families can explore tea-growing areas, viewpoints and nearby natural attractions while keeping the itinerary flexible.

For families travelling with younger children, avoid packing too many sightseeing stops into one day. A slower itinerary allows everyone to enjoy Munnar without spending most of the day travelling between attractions.

Alleppey

Alleppey, also known as Alappuzha, is best known for Kerala's backwaters and houseboat experiences. A family can include a houseboat stay or a shorter backwater experience depending on the children's age and the overall itinerary.

It is particularly useful for families looking to combine sightseeing with relaxation rather than visiting attractions throughout the entire day.

 

Thekkady

Thekkady is a good addition to a Kerala family trip for travellers interested in forests, wildlife and nature. Families can explore suitable local experiences and spend time around the Periyar region.

When planning activities with children, consider their age, comfort and the duration of each experience before adding multiple activities to the same day.

Wayanad

Wayanad offers a different side of Kerala, with forests, hills, waterfalls and nature-focused experiences. It can work well for families who want more outdoor experiences during their holiday.

Families should allow enough time for travel between attractions instead of trying to cover too many places in a single day.

Kovalam

Kovalam is a popular option for families who want to finish their Kerala trip with some beach time. A relaxed beach stay can balance a sightseeing-heavy itinerary that includes destinations such as Munnar and Thekkady.

Families can choose accommodation close to the activities they want to enjoy and keep additional sightseeing optional.

Kochi

Kochi is useful as the starting or ending point of a Kerala itinerary and offers opportunities to experience the state's history, architecture and culture.

A short stay in Kochi can complement a longer itinerary focused on Munnar, Thekkady and Alleppey.

Kid-Friendly Activities in Kerala

Houseboat Cruises

One of the best things of Family trip to Kerala is go on a houseboat tour through the backwaters. The trip is relaxing for adults and fun for kids because it moves slowly, has comfy decks, tasty food, and beautiful views. 

 

Wildlife Encounters & Nature Walks 

Kerala with kids is a safe place to see wildlife and learn about it. Families can have fun in Periyar by going on boat safaris and short wildlife walks with a guide. Children can play on easy trails in Eravikulam National Park and tea farms in Munnar. 

Waterfalls & Spice Plantation Tours

Families can enjoy nature up close at well-known waterfalls such as Attukal, Lakkam, and Cheeyappara. Kids will also love spice plantation tours in Thekkady. They can see where pepper, cinnamon, cardamom, and cloves grow while going through fragrant, shaded farms. It is one of the Kid-friendly activities in Kerala
 

 

Cultural Shows: Kathakali & Kalaripayattu 

Kerala's traditional shows are bright, fun, and interesting for kids. Kathakali performances have fancy outfits and emotional stories that make people interested. The ancient martial art of Kerala, Kalaripayattu, is just as impressive with its fast moves and complex choreography. 

Estimated Kerala Family Itinerary (5 Days)

Day 1: Arrive in Kochi and Travel to Munnar

Arrive in Kerala and continue towards Munnar. Keep the first day relaxed after the journey and spend the evening enjoying the surroundings.

Day 2: Explore Munnar

Spend the day exploring Munnar's tea gardens, viewpoints and selected family-friendly attractions.

Day 3: Munnar to Thekkady

Travel towards Thekkady and spend the afternoon exploring the destination at a comfortable pace.

Day 4: Thekkady to Alleppey

Continue to Alleppey and enjoy a backwater experience. Depending on your package, you can choose a houseboat stay or another backwater activity.

Day 5: Alleppey to Kochi and Departure

Enjoy a relaxed morning before travelling back towards Kochi for your departure.

Travel Tips for Families Visiting Kerala 

Packing Essentials

Bring sunscreen, hats, light cotton clothes, comfy shoes, bug spray, and basic medicines. Kerala's weather can change quickly, so a light jacket is helpful in hill towns. 

Food Recommendations for Kids 

Kids can enjoy mild curries, steamed rice meals, fresh fruits, appam, dosa, and idiyappam in Kerala. For picky eaters, most places also offer continental and North Indian food. 

Safety Tips at Beaches & During Boat Rides

Choose places with lifeguards, stay away from deep water, and watch your kids at all times. Life jackets should be worn on boat rides, and people should not lean over the rails.
